In a video that was posted few hours ago by Goal Africa on their official Facebook page, Wilfred Ndidi was asked to name his all time Super Eagles 5-A-side.

After initially struggling to pick his all time favorite Super Eagles players, he finally settled for Napoli striker, Victor Osimehn, former super eagles midfielders, Jay Jay Okocha, and Mikel Obi.

Other players on the list include former Super Eagles captain, Joseph Yobo, Leganés defender, Kenneth Omeruo, and former Wolverhampton Wanderers goalkeeper, Carl Onora Ikeme.

Surprisingly, there was no space for his best friend and Leicester City teammate, Kelechi Iheanacho. Earlier though, he had mentioned Kelechi Iheanacho as the only Footballer he will likely invite to a dinner.

Onyinye Wilfred Ndidi (born 16 December 1996) is a Nigerian professional footballer who plays as a defensive midfielder for Premier League club Leicester City and the Nigeria national team. Ndidi is known for his defensive prowess and long range strikes.
